To successfully create your tent, you will need a few key materials. These include clear heavy-duty plastic for the tent walls, duct tape or waterproof adhesive for sealing seams, and an air pump to inflate the structure.
The choice of plastic is crucial as it determines visibility and durability. Opt for a thick, transparent type that can withstand outdoor conditions.
The assembly process involves careful planning and precise execution. Start by laying out your plastic sheet and cutting it according to your design blueprint.
Create framework using PVC pipes before moving on to inflation. Remember not to overinflate as this could cause damage or even lead to bursting.
